Transaction 57ac7576039dcdcae691e017582e4a6f222295f604b7e970b2ecb6985d34df11
1 Input
2 Outputs
- 57ac7576039dcdcae691e017582e4a6f222295f604b7e970b2ecb6985d34df11:0
- 57ac7576039dcdcae691e017582e4a6f222295f604b7e970b2ecb6985d34df11:1
value 9580
address 17R3KMDvNYBWpRUaxtNs2yE7a6GF2toF2k
value 109735
address 134do44rtEfGkCyqRts5Nzx7baeS3UnYYT